The United States of America, acting through the Millennium Challenge Corporation (“MCC”) and the Government of Ghana (the “Government” or “GoG”) have entered into a Millennium Challenge Compact for Millennium Challenge Account assistance to help facilitate poverty reduction through economic growth in Ghana (the “Compact”) in the amount of approximately Four Hundred and Ninety-Eight Million, Two Hundred Thousand United States Dollars (US$ 498,200,000) (“MCC Funding”). Pursuant to the terms of the Compact, the Government committed to provide funding as a Government contribution to support implementation of the Compact in an amount equal to no less than seven and one-half percent (7.5%) of the amount of funding provided by MCC in the Compact (the “Government Contribution”).
2. Under the Compact’s Energy Efficiency and Demand Side Management (EEDSM) Project, MiDA is undertaking a “Development and Enforcement of Standards and Labels Activity”. This activity consists of upgrading existing standards and labels, developing new standards and labels for a broad range of selected electrical appliances and equipment, as well as constructing an Air Conditioning Containment Building for a room type calorimeter for performance testing non-ducted room air conditioning and heat pump (RAC) units in accordance with ISO 5151:2015. There is likely to be some basic architectural design work required in the process.

7. Objective
The objective of the activity is to design and build a Containment Building to house the AC Test Facility Laboratory equipment for the Ghana Standards Authority.
The selected Firm will receive a package of conceptual design and technical specifications for illustration purposes to give an indication of the projected building.
The projected building (about 19 meters by 25 meters) is a concrete frame structure made up of reinforced concrete foundations, reinforced concrete columns, masonry walls as infills and partitions. Roofing is aluminum roofing sheet. The minimum clear height inside the building is about 7 meters under the roof structure. Finishing are glass windows with aluminum frame, exterior metal doors and interior hardwood doors, heavy-duty industrial floor tiles (main hall), ceramic wall tiling in toilets, painted internal and external walls. Installations include Electrical, Plumbing, Fire safety and Air-conditioning Installations for the office areas.
Also, there is on the site, one level building (masonry walls with metal roof - about 6m x 40m) to be demolished, and some trees to remove.
